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main function of the ActiveCampaign Trigger node?

This node allows your n8n workflows to start automatically whenever a specific event occurs within your ActiveCampaign account. It acts as the initial trigger for your workflow automations.

What kinds of events can trigger an n8n workflow using this component?

You can configure the trigger to listen for various events such as contact updates, tag additions/removals, or subscription status changes. This ensures seamless Integrations between your CRM and n8n processes.

How does the ActiveCampaign Trigger communicate with n8n?

The trigger node automatically sets up a webhook in your ActiveCampaign application. When the specified event occurs, ActiveCampaign sends a payload to this webhook, which fires the n8n workflow.

Is the ActiveCampaign Trigger component necessary if I only want to update data in ActiveCampaign?

No. The trigger node is only used to start a workflow based on an ActiveCampaign event. If you need to manipulate or send data to ActiveCampaign, you should use the standard ActiveCampaign regular node.

How do I ensure the trigger node is listening continuously for new ActiveCampaign events?

Once the workflow containing the trigger node is activated, n8n handles the necessary Integrations configuration to ensure that the trigger remains active and ready to fire whenever the configured ActiveCampaign event happens.
